At INSPYR Solutions, we are seeking a highly skilled PC Network Technician to join our team. As a PC Network Technician, you will be responsible for ensuring the proper operation of computer systems, resolving technical issues, and providing exceptional customer service.
Key Responsibilities:- Field incoming help requests from end-users via telephone and email in a courteous manner.
- Document all pertinent end-user information, including name, department, contact information, and nature of problem or issue in the Help Desk problem reporting system.
- Build rapport and elicit problem details from help desk customers.
- Prioritize and schedule problems, escalating them when required to the appropriately experienced technician.
- Record, track, and document the help desk request problem-solving process, including all successful and unsuccessful decisions made, and actions taken, through to final resolution.
- Apply diagnostic utilities to aid in troubleshooting.
- Access software updates, drivers, knowledge bases, and frequently asked questions resources on the Internet to aid in problem resolution.
- Identify and learn appropriate software and hardware used and supported by the organization.
- Perform hands-on fixes at the desktop level, including installing and upgrading software, installing hardware, implementing file backups, and configuring systems and applications.
- Perform preventative maintenance, including checking and cleaning of workstations, printers, and peripherals.
- Test fixes to ensure the problem has been adequately resolved.
- Perform post-resolution follow-ups to help requests.
- Evaluate documented resolutions and analyze trends for ways to prevent future problems.
- Utilize help sheets and frequently asked questions lists for end-users.
